- 博客(28)
- 收藏
- 关注
原创 黑马程序员——银行业务调度系统
---------------------- ASP.Net+Android+IOS开发.Net培训、期待与您交流! ---------------------- 银行业务调度系统具体需求:银行内有6个业务窗口,1 - 4号窗口为普通窗口,5号窗口为快速窗口,6号窗口为VIP窗口。有三种对应类型的客户:VIP客户,普通客户,快速客户(办理如交水电费、电话费之类业务的客户)。
2014-01-02 13:43:00
523
原创 黑马程序员——交通灯管理系统
---------------------- ASP.Net+Android+IOS开发、.Net培训、期待与您交流! ---------------------- 交通灯管理系统:异步随机生成按照各个路线行驶的车辆。例如: 由南向而来去往北向的车辆 右转车辆 由东向而来去往南向的车辆 ---- 左转车辆 。。。信号灯忽略黄
2014-01-01 23:51:44
543
原创 黑马程序员——类加载器&代理
------- android培训、java培训、期待与您交流! ---------- 类加载器的作用就是将class文件加载到内存中,以实现对其的调用。这是Java中一种特有的机制,所有的类都是通过加载器加载进内存中的,这种方式保证了安全性。 类加载器同时也是一种类,那么它也需要被类加载器加载,这么一直推算下来,总一个有所加载器的父加载器,那么它是如何加载进内存中的呢?这个类
2014-01-01 21:16:42
704
原创 黑马程序员——注解&泛型
------- android培训、java培训、期待与您交流! ---------- jdk1.5提供的3个主要注解:1. @SuppressWarmings:忽略警告(可以是各种类型的警告)2. @Deprecated:声明已过时的方法3. @Override:用于覆盖,测试是否为复写的方法 注解相当于一种标记,在程序中加了注解等于为程序打上了某种标记。
2013-12-31 23:16:11
506
原创 黑马程序员——反射
------ android培训、java培训、期待与您交流! ---------- 反射是Java中最重要的概念之一,它可以构成各个框架,能快速的搭建需要的类。所以,学Java就必须掌握好反射的应用。Java程序中各个Java类属于同一类事物,描述这类事物的Java类名就是Class。Class类是反射的基石,只有通过Class类才能实现反射的功能。获取Class对象的
2013-12-31 17:40:03
604
原创 黑马程序员——枚举
------- android培训、java培训、期待与您交流! ---------- 枚举为什么要有枚举问题:要定义星期几或性别的变量,该怎么定义?假设用1-7分别表示星期一到星期日,但有人可能会写成int weekday = 0;或即使使用常量方式也无法阻止意外。枚举就是要让某个类型的变量的取值只能为若干个固定值中的一个,否则,编译器就会报错。枚举可以让编译器在编译时就
2013-12-30 11:42:46
585
原创 黑马程序员——正则表达式
------- android培训、java培训、期待与您交流! ---------- 正则表达式:是指一个用来描述或者匹配一系列符合某个句法规则的字符串的单个字符串。其实就是一种规则,有自己特殊的应用。可以简化对字符串的复杂操作弊端:符号定义越多,正则越长,阅读性差 字符类[^abc] 任何字符,除了 a、b 或 c(否定)[a-zA-Z]
2013-12-29 22:47:19
651
原创 黑马程序员——网络编程
------- android培训、java培训、期待与您交流! ---------- 网络模型:1. OSI参考模型2. TCP/IP参考模型网络通讯要素:1. IP地址2. 端口号3. 传输协议 网络参考协议分层结构图: 网络通讯要素:1. IP地址:InetAddress 网络中设备的标识 IPv4:4个字
2013-12-29 17:14:12
723
原创 黑马程序员——GUI
------- android培训、java培训、期待与您交流! ---------- GUIGraphical User Interface(图形用户接口)。用图形的方式,来显示计算机操作的界面,这样更方便更直观。 Java为GUI提供的对象都存在java.Awt抽象窗口工具包,需要调用本地系统方法实现功能。属重量级控件 javax.Swing基于Awt基础,建立
2013-12-28 23:56:58
505
原创 黑马程序员——IO中其它流
------- android培训、java培训、期待与您交流! ---------- 打印流字节打印流 PrintStream构造函数可以接受的参数类型1,file对象 File2,字符串路径,String3,字节输出流 OutputStream 字符打印流PrintWriter 构造函数可以接受的参数类型1,file对象 File
2013-12-28 20:15:33
535
原创 黑马程序员——File
------- android培训、java培训、期待与您交流! ----------File类对象可以代表一个路径,此路径可以是文件也可以是文件夹,该类方法可以对这个路径进行各种操作File用来将文件或者文件夹封装成对象方便对文件与文件夹的属性信息进行操作。File对象可以作为参数传递给流的构造函数。 创建对象给File类构造函数传一个String类型的路径就可以
2013-12-28 17:04:09
601
原创 黑马程序员——字节流
------- android培训、java培训、期待与您交流! ---------- IO流用来处理设备之间的数据传输Java对数据的操作是通过流的方式Java用于操作流的类都在IO包中流按流向分为两种:输入流,输出流。流按操作类型分为两种:字节流与字符流。 字节流可以操作任何数据,字符流只能操作纯字符数据,比较方便。 字节流的抽象父类:InputS
2013-12-27 19:37:35
535
原创 黑马程序员——字符流
------- android培训、java培训、期待与您交流! ---------- 字符流是可以直接读写字符的IO流创建流对象,建立数据存放文件(在创建一个文件时,如果目录下有同名文件将被覆盖。)FileWriter fw = new FileWriter(“demo.txt”);调用流对象的写入方法,将数据写入流fw.write(“abc”);刷新流对象中的
2013-12-27 00:06:48
553
原创 黑马程序员——Map集合
------- android培训、java培训、期待与您交流! ---------- Map 一次存两个对象,键值对 HashMap 使用哈希算法对键去重复,效率高,但无序。允许null键和null值 TreeMap 使用二叉树算法排序,可以自定义顺序 LinkedHashMap 使用哈希算法去重复,并且
2013-12-26 15:39:43
548
原创 黑马程序员——Set集合
------- android培训、java培训、期待与您交流! ---------- Set 不可重复,没索引 HashSet 底层是哈希表,使用哈希算法去重复, 效率高,但元素无序 TreeSet 底层结构是二叉树。TreeSet是用排序的,可以指定一个顺序,对象存入之后会按照指定的顺序排列 LinkedHash
2013-12-25 21:12:02
443
原创 黑马程序员——集合框架&List
------- android培训、java培训、期待与您交流! ---------- 面向对象语言对事物的体现都是以对象的形式,所以为了方便对多个对象的操作,就对对象进行存储,集合就是存储对象最常用的一种方式。 集合只用于存储对象,集合长度是可变的,集合可以存储不同类型的对象。 集合的分类1、Collection 一次存一个对象,
2013-12-25 17:25:29
433
原创 黑马程序员——多线程
------- android培训、java培训、期待与您交流! ----------线程的定义进程:当前正在执行的程序,代表一个应用程序在内存中的执行区域。线程:是进程中的一个执行控制单元,执行路径。一个进程中如果只有一个执行路径,这个程序称为单线程。一个进程中有多个执行路径时,这个程序成为多线程。多线程的好处:它的出现可以同时执行多条路径,让多部分代码同时执行,提高
2013-12-22 18:45:25
376
原创 黑马程序员——异常
------- android培训、java培训、期待与您交流! ---------- 异常:异常就是Java程序在运行过程中出现不正常情况。异常由来:问题也是现实生活中一个具体事务,也可以通过java 的类的形式进行描述,并封装成对象。其实就是Java对不正常情况进行描述后的对象体现。 Throvable类是java语言中所有错误或异常的超类 对于严重问题,j
2013-12-21 19:20:39
486
原创 黑马程序员——内部类
------- android培训、java培训、期待与您交流! ---------- 内部类:将一个类定义在另一个类的里面,对里面那个类就称为内部类(内置类,嵌套类)。内部类的出现再次打破了java单继承的局限性内部类是指在一个外部类的内部再定义一个类。 内部类作为外部类的一个成员,并且依附于外部类而存在的。 内部类可为静态,可用protected和private修饰。(
2013-12-21 14:29:14
441
原创 黑马程序员——多态
------- android培训、java培训、期待与您交流! ---------- 多态:某一类事物的多种存在形态多态的体现:父类的引用指向自己的子类对象对象多态的前提: 1:类与类(或接口)要有继承(或实现)关系。 2:一定要有方法的覆盖。多态的好处 多态的出现大大的提高了程序的扩展性。 多态的弊端 提高了扩展性,但是只能使用父类的引
2013-12-21 12:19:03
437
原创 黑马程序员——抽象类&接口
------- android培训、java培训、期待与您交流! ---------- 抽象类的特点:1,抽象方法一定在抽象类中2,抽象方法和抽象类都必须被abstract关键字修饰3, 抽象类不可以用new创建对象,因为调用抽象方法没意义4,抽象类中的抽象方法要被使用,必须由子类复写起所有的抽象方法后,建立子类对象调用。 如果子类只覆盖了部分的抽象方法,那么该子
2013-12-21 00:21:43
440
原创 黑马程序员——继承
------- android培训、java培训、期待与您交流! ----------继承的好处: 继承的出现,提高了代码的复用性。 继承的出现,让类与类之间产生了关系,extends来表示,这个关系的出现,就有了面向对象的第三个特点多态。继承的体系结构:就是对要描述的事物进行不断的向上抽取,就出现了体系结构。 要了解这个体系结构中最共性的内容,就看最顶层的类。 要
2013-12-20 22:58:01
441
原创 黑马程序员——单例设计模式
------- android培训、java培训、期待与您交流! ------- 单例模式是指:对于一个类在内存中只能存在唯一一个对象, 饿汉式(先初始化对象,Single类一进内存就创建好了对象)1,将构造函数私有化2,在类中创建一个本类对象3, 提供一个方法可以获取到该对象 class Single { private Si
2013-12-20 21:44:08
527
原创 黑马程序员——面向对象(封装、构造函数、静态)
------- android培训、java培训、期待与您交流! ----------面向对象面向对象的特点: 1:封装 2:继承 3:多态 面向对象是相对面向过程而言。面向对象和面向过程都是一种思想面向过程:强调的功能的行为,执行者面向对象:将功能封装进对象,强调具备了功能的对象。指挥者面向对象是基于面向过程的。面向对象思想的特点
2013-12-20 20:37:58
468
原创 黑马程序员——语句、函数和数组
------- android培训、java培训、期待与您交流! ----------判断语句——ifif语句 三种格式:1、if(条件表达式){ //如果满足就执行不满足就结束 执行语句; }2、if(条件表达式){ //如果满足条件就执行“执行语句1”,否则的话执行“执行语句2” 执行语句1; } else{ 执行语句2;
2013-12-20 13:04:14
422
原创 黑马程序员——java语言基础组成
------- android培训、java培训、期待与您交流! ---------- Java语言基础组成关键字的定义和特点定义:被Java语言赋予了特殊含义的,用于专门用途的单词。特点:关键字中所有字母都为小写用于定义数据类型的关键字class interface byte short int long
2013-12-19 22:21:26
496
原创 黑马程序员——java基础
------- android培训、java培训、期待与您交流! ----------软件:一系列按照特定顺序组织的计算机数据和指令的集合。常见系统软件:DOS,windows,linux等。常见应用软件:QQ,迅雷,百度影音等。什么是开发:制作软件 人机交互: 图形化界面:简单直观,容易操作。 命
2013-12-19 18:54:13
384
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人